INFORMATION PAGE OF MASTER THESIS
Name of thesis: ³
Extraction, determination of chemical constituents and isolation of
Crinum asiaticum L. LQ'D1DQJFLW\´
Major: organic chemistry
Full name of Master student: Le Le
Supervisors: Dr. Tran Manh Luc
Training institution: University of Education- The University of Danang
1. Summary of research results
Through experimental research, the following results were obtained:
+ Selection of materials:
Selection the stem and roots of Crinum asiaticum L. as a research material in the
dissertation because the volume and content of ethanol extraction.
+ Determine the amount of ethanol extract obtained from Crinum asiaticum L. army: root
part 36.12%; leaf part 28.36%; stem part 24.88% and the flower part 14.65%.
+ Prepare fraction separated from ethanol extract:
Hexane extract: 5.92% with stem and 3.88% with root.
Dichloromethane extract: 1.45% with the body and 1.32% with root.
Ethyl acetate extract: 1.74% with stem and 1.54% with root.
Water extract: 86.11% with stem and 87.70% with root.
+ Qualitative analysis of the fraction separated from ethanol extract the stem and root of
Crinum asiaticum L.
+ High hexane fractionation and mass spectrometry (GC-MS) identified 25 components of
the stem and 26 components of the root.
+ Used thin-plate chromatography, chromatography columns to isolate the segment hexane
extract from the ethanol extract of Crinum asiaticum L. The results obtained 03 segments with a
number of substances enriched very large compared to the original, and also discovered some new
substances, including some high-quality substances. As follows:
